'Goat's Rue' or 'Virginia Goat's-rue' (tef-ROH-see-uh: vir-jin-ee-AN-uh)
This
is a hairy perennial Pea with bi-colored pink and yellow flowers. Plants have deep taproots
making transplanting very difficult. Grow in full sun in prairie- type habitats. Soils should be
well-draining and non-calcareous. Sandy soil works well for this dune species.
Zones
3-9. Native from the eastern half of the USA. This pea like plant has deep taproots, and should be
started in place of growth or use deep cell pots and use quick draining soil medium, wet soil will
cause root rot.
